Output 8396ab24b36e861362ccb1511719912b6432f9c588448edd49052f73fe4ab801:4

value
33072276
script pubkey
OP_0 OP_PUSHBYTES_20 84d04a8028d34c0b6d0cbd74de6fed190b951bd7
address
bc1qsngy4qpg6dxqkmgvh46dumldry9e2x7hg35ftl
transaction
8396ab24b36e861362ccb1511719912b6432f9c588448edd49052f73fe4ab801
spent
true